Unlocking Mental Wellness: A Guide to Self-Care and Mindfulness
Mental wellness is a crucial aspect of overall well-being. It includes our emotional, psychological, and social health, influencing how we feel the world and navigate its obstacles.
In today's fast-paced environment, it's easy to feel overwhelmed and disconnected. Taking intentional steps to nurture our mental health is therefore vitally important.
Self-care practices can significantly enhance our well-being. Incorporating in activities that rejuvenate us helps to promote calmness.
- Examples of self-care include:
- Connecting with the natural world
- Practicing mindfulness meditation
- Reading books or listening to music
- Getting adequate sleep
- Nurturing relationships
Mindfulness is a beneficial tool for improving mental wellness. It involves being present in the moment. By incorporating mindful practices, we can reduce stress, improve focus, and increase self-awareness.
Remember, taking care of your mental health is an ongoing commitment. Be patient with yourself, and don't hesitate to reach out for help if you need it.
